  • 2010 - gold medal in the relay, silver medal in the 12.5 km mass start
  • 2006 - gold medal in the relay

  • 2009 - Gold medal in the 12.5 km mass start and the relay, bronze in the 7.5 km sprint and 10 km pursuit
  • 2005 - Gold medal in the relay, silver in the 15 km individual and the mixed relay and bronze in the pursuit
